It is important to act within the first 24 to 48 hours after a fire to stabilize and recover as much of your home as possible. In addition, addressing the negative effects of smoke quickly prevents additional damage and toxic smoke odors from further absorbing into your home or belongings. If left untreated by professionals, smoke damage can quickly discolor your walls, create strong odors, and cause ongoing problems in your home.
